### Localization Gotchas
**Religion custom loc requires mapping blocks.** Simply adding faith-prefixed
keys to your `.yml` files (e.g., `my_faith_HighGodName:0 "The Creator"`) is
NOT sufficient. You must also add a `localization = { }` block to each
religion in the definition file that maps generic key names to your prefixed
loc strings:
```
my_religion = {
localization = {
HighGodName = my_faith_HighGodName
HighGodNamePossessive = my_faith_HighGodNamePossessive
PriestMale = my_faith_PriestMale
PriestFemale = my_faith_PriestFemale
# ... 128 keys total (see vanilla 00_christianity.txt for full list)
}
faiths = { ... }
}
```
Without these mapping blocks, CK3 cannot find your faith-specific loc keys
and ck3-tiger reports hundreds of `missing-localization` warnings.
**Trait keys are looked up with double prefix.** CK3 looks up traits as both
`trait_name` and `trait_trait_name`. If your traits use a `trait_` prefix
(e.g., `trait_misting_coinshot`), you need loc entries for both
`trait_misting_coinshot` and `trait_trait_misting_coinshot` (name + desc).
**Name list names need loc keys.** Every name in `male_names` and
`female_names` blocks of a name list requires a localization entry
(`Kelsier:0 "Kelsier"`). Names without loc still work but generate
ck3-tiger warnings.
**County titles need adjective keys.** CK3 uses `<county_key>_adj` for
demonyms (e.g., `c_luthadel_adj:0 "Luthadel"`). These are separate from
the county name loc.
**Culture/heritage/language need extra keys.** Beyond the base key and
`_desc`, cultures need `_prefix` and `_collective_noun`; heritage and
language pillars need `_name` variants; traditions need `_name` variants
and `culture_parameter_*` bonus description keys.
**Province history for total conversions.** Vanilla provinces without any
history definition generate "Province with no county data" errors. Provide
`holding = none` defaults for unused provinces. But do NOT redefine provinces
that vanilla already has history for — that creates `duplicate-field` warnings.
Only cover the gap: provinces with zero history anywhere.

| Religion loc not found | Missing `localization = { }` mapping block in religion definition | Add mapping block to each religion (see Localization Gotchas) |
| Hundreds of trait loc warnings | CK3 looks up `trait_trait_X` in addition to `trait_X` | Add double-prefix loc entries for all traits |
| Province log flooding | Vanilla provinces without history in your TC | Add `holding = none` defaults for unused province IDs (skip vanilla-defined ones) |
